Stone Driveway Construction Questions
What are common uses for stone driveways? Stone driveways are often used for residential entrances, parking areas, and pathways due to their durability and aesthetic appeal.
How long does a stone driveway typically last? With proper installation and maintenance, stone driveways can last several decades, providing long-term performance.
What types of stones are suitable for driveways? Popular options include granite, limestone, and flagstone, chosen for their strength and visual appeal.
Are stone driveways suitable for all climates? Yes, stone driveways generally perform well in various climates, but proper drainage and installation help prevent damage.
